WebFeb 25, 2024 · How to clean your pool filter with soap One way is to fill a bucket halfway with warm water and submerge the filter entirely. Then, add one cup of liquid dish soap or dishwasher detergent for every five gallons of water. Allow one to eight hours for the filter to soak before removing it and rinsing it with the hose. As you wash the dishwasher filter, you may need to use a soft brush and dish soap on calcium deposits … countries and nationalities lesson planThe first step in cleaning your DE filter is to perform a backwashing cycle to clear out excess debris. Turn off your pool pump, then switch the filter valve to the ‘backwash’ setting. Restart your pool pump and run the backwash cycle until the water coming out of the discharge hose runs clear.
